Carolyn Carpeneti, Mayor Willie Brown's fund-raiser and mother of his 2-year-old daughter, has been paid at least $2.33 million over the past five years by nonprofit groups and political committees controlled by the mayor and his allies, public records show. But Carpeneti told Bibbs that the firm could not give $25,000 to the mayor because of the city's $750 cap on individual donations. Hiring Carpeneti is the price politicians or political groups must pay to get Brown's help with a fund-raiser in San Francisco, political professionals say.
